Kentucky Bourbon Dinner

Friday, October 18th

6 courses featuring rare bourbons, followed by cigars

$350 / person including tax and gratuity and a bottle of 1988 Old Weller Antique 107 (Stitzel Weller)

Country Ham, scrambled eggs, sweet corn grits, red eye gravy, maple gastrique

-Old Forester Birthday Bourbon 2013

Chicken liver ravioli, sea urchin sauce, fresh Alaskan king crab legs

-Four Roses Single Barrel Limited Edition 2013

Fischer Farms ribeye cap, smoked mushroom puree, mushroom spinach ragout

-Elijah Craig 21 year (Bardstown)

Bourbon barbeque veal cheeks, Kentucky fried sweetbreads, corn bread

-Parker's Heritage Promise of Hope 7th Edition

Foie Gras torchon "manhatten"

foie gras torchon, hibiscus flower-sweet vermouth gelee, bourbon macerated dried cherries, cocoa nib salt "bitters"

-Jefferson's Reserve Presidential Select 18yr (Stitzel Weller)

Apple chesnut tart & Capriole Farms O'banon goat cheese

-1988 Old Weller Antique 107 (Stitzel Weller)

Cigars to follow
